Born as a massive submarine volcano, growing thousands of metres to the ocean surface, encrusted, polyp by polyp, by stony coral, repeatedly submerged and uplifted, colonised by an unusual and unique array of plants and animals and continuing on a slow side towards and inevitable dive into the Java Trench., Christmas Island has provided a setting for the dynamic interplays of nature over millions of years.
